Dazzle Dry is a nail polish system. You start with a nail prep. Then you put on one coat of the base coat. Then you put on one or two coats of whatever color you choose. After that, you follow up with a top coat to seal it. You need to let each coat dry completely but it is seriously completely dry in about five minutes. Not only that, Dazzle Dry is vegan and contains no harmful chemicals like toluene, phthalate, camphor or formaldehyde.  It's also the only nail polish on the market that is nitrocellulose free!  It even has UV protective screening.
